106def run(repo_or_json, outputPrefix=None, makePrint=True, makePlot=True, 

107 level='design', metrics_package='verify_metrics', **kwargs): 

108 """Main entrypoint from ``validateDrp.py``. 

109 

110 Parameters 

111 ---------- 

112 repo_or_json : `str` 

113 The repository. This is generally the directory on disk 

114 that contains the repository and mapper. 

115 This can also be the filepath for a JSON file that contains 

116 the cached output from a previous run. 

117 makePrint : `bool`, optional 

118 Print calculated quantities (to stdout). 

119 makePlot : `bool`, optional 

120 Create plots for metrics. Saved to current working directory. 

121 level : `str` 

122 Use <level> E.g., 'design', 'minimum', 'stretch'. 

123 """ 

124 base_name, ext = os.path.splitext(repo_or_json) 

125 if ext == '.json': 

126 load_json = True 

127 else: 

128 load_json = False 

129 

130 # I think I have to interrogate the kwargs to maintain compatibility 

131 # between Python 2 and Python 3 

132 # In Python 3 I would have let me mix in a keyword default after *args 

133 if outputPrefix is None: 

134 outputPrefix = repoNameToPrefix(base_name) 

135 

136 if load_json: 

137 if not os.path.isfile(repo_or_json): 

138 print("Could not find JSON file %s" % (repo_or_json)) 

139 return 

140 

141 json_path = repo_or_json 

142 job = load_json_output(json_path, metrics_package) 

143 filterName = get_filter_name_from_job(job) 

144 jobs = {filterName: job} 

145 else: 

146 if not os.path.isdir(repo_or_json): 

147 print("Could not find repo %s" % (repo_or_json)) 

148 return 

149 

150 repo_path = repo_or_json 

151 jobs = runOneRepo(repo_path, outputPrefix=outputPrefix, 

152 metrics_package=metrics_package, **kwargs) 

153 

154 for filterName, job in jobs.items(): 

155 if makePrint: 

156 print_metrics(job) 

157 if makePlot: 

158 if outputPrefix is None or outputPrefix == '': 

159 thisOutputPrefix = "%s" % filterName 

160 else: 

161 thisOutputPrefix = "%s_%s" % (outputPrefix, filterName) 

162 plot_metrics(job, filterName, outputPrefix=thisOutputPrefix) 

163 

164 print_pass_fail_summary(jobs, default_level=level) 

165

167def runOneRepo(repo, dataIds=None, outputPrefix='', verbose=False, 

168 instrument=None, dataset_repo_url=None, 

169 metrics_package='verify_metrics', **kwargs): 

170 r"""Calculate statistics for all filters in a repo. 

171 

172 Runs multiple filters, if necessary, through repeated calls to `runOneFilter`. 

173 Assesses results against SRD specs at specified `level`. 

174 

175 Parameters 

176 --------- 

177 repo : `str` 

178 The repository. This is generally the directory on disk 

179 that contains the repository and mapper. 

180 dataIds : `list` of `dict` 

181 List of butler data IDs of Image catalogs to compare to reference. 

182 The calexp cpixel image is needed for the photometric calibration. 

183 Tract IDs must be included if "doApplyExternalPhotoCalib" or 

184 "doApplyExternalSkyWcs" is True. 

185 outputPrefix : `str`, optional 

186 Specify the beginning filename for output files. 

187 The name of each filter will be appended to outputPrefix. 

188 level : `str`, optional 

189 The level of the specification to check: "design", "minimum", "stretch". 

190 verbose : `bool` 

191 Provide detailed output. 

192 instrument : `str` 

193 Name of the instrument. If None will be extracted from the Butler mapper. 

194 dataset_repo_url : `str` 

195 Location of the dataset used. If None will be set to the path of the repo. 

196 metrics_package : `string` 

197 Name of the metrics package to be used in the Jobs created. 

198 

199 Notes 

200 ----- 

201 Names of plot files or JSON file are generated based on repository name, 

202 unless overriden by specifying `ouputPrefix`. 

203 E.g., Analyzing a repository ``CFHT/output`` 

204 will result in filenames that start with ``CFHT_output_``. 

205 The filter name is added to this prefix. If the filter name has spaces, 

206 there will be annoyance and sadness as those spaces will appear in the filenames. 

207 """ 

208 

209 def extract_instrument_from_repo(repo): 

210 """Extract the last part of the mapper name from a Butler repo. 

211 'lsst.obs.lsstSim.lsstSimMapper.LsstSimMapper' -> 'LSSTSIM' 

212 'lsst.obs.cfht.megacamMapper.MegacamMapper' -> 'CFHT' 

213 'lsst.obs.decam.decamMapper.DecamMapper' -> 'DECAM' 

214 'lsst.obs.hsc.hscMapper.HscMapper' -> 'HSC' 

215 """ 

216 mapper_class = Butler.getMapperClass(repo) 

217 instrument = mapper_class.getCameraName() 

218 return instrument.upper() 

219 

220 if instrument is None: 

221 instrument = extract_instrument_from_repo(repo) 

222 if dataset_repo_url is None: 

223 dataset_repo_url = repo 

224 

225 allFilters = set([d['filter'] for d in dataIds]) 

226 

227 jobs = {} 

228 for filterName in allFilters: 

229 # Do this here so that each outputPrefix will have a different name for each filter. 

230 if outputPrefix is None or outputPrefix == '': 

231 thisOutputPrefix = "%s" % filterName 

232 else: 

233 thisOutputPrefix = "%s_%s" % (outputPrefix, filterName) 

234 theseVisitDataIds = [v for v in dataIds if v['filter'] == filterName] 

235 job = runOneFilter(repo, theseVisitDataIds, 

236 outputPrefix=thisOutputPrefix, 

237 verbose=verbose, filterName=filterName, 

238 instrument=instrument, 

239 dataset_repo_url=dataset_repo_url, 

240 metrics_package=metrics_package, **kwargs) 

241 jobs[filterName] = job 

242 

243 return jobs

246def runOneFilter(repo, visitDataIds, brightSnrMin=None, brightSnrMax=None, 

247 makeJson=True, filterName=None, outputPrefix='', 

248 doApplyExternalPhotoCalib=False, externalPhotoCalibName=None, 

249 doApplyExternalSkyWcs=False, externalSkyWcsName=None, 

250 skipTEx=False, verbose=False, 

251 metrics_package='verify_metrics', 

252 instrument='Unknown', dataset_repo_url='./', 

253 skipNonSrd=False, **kwargs): 

254 r"""Main executable for the case where there is just one filter. 

255 

256 Plot files and JSON files are generated in the local directory 

257 prefixed with the repository name (where '_' replace path separators), 

258 unless overriden by specifying `outputPrefix`. 

259 E.g., Analyzing a repository ``CFHT/output`` 

260 will result in filenames that start with ``CFHT_output_``. 

261 

262 Parameters 

263 ---------- 

264 repo : string or Butler 

265 A Butler or a repository URL that can be used to construct one. 

266 dataIds : list of dict 

267 List of `butler` data IDs of Image catalogs to compare to reference. 

268 The `calexp` pixel image is needed for the photometric calibration 

269 unless doApplyExternalPhotoCalib is True such 

270 that the appropriate `photoCalib` dataset is used. Note that these 

271 have data IDs that include the tract number. 

272 brightSnrMin : float, optional 

273 Minimum median SNR for a source to be considered bright; passed to 

274 `lsst.validate.drp.matchreduce.build_matched_dataset`. 

275 brightSnrMax : float, optional 

276 Maximum median SNR for a source to be considered bright; passed to 

277 `lsst.validate.drp.matchreduce.build_matched_dataset`. 

278 makeJson : bool, optional 

279 Create JSON output file for metrics. Saved to current working directory. 

280 outputPrefix : str, optional 

281 Specify the beginning filename for output files. 

282 filterName : str, optional 

283 Name of the filter (bandpass). 

284 doApplyExternalPhotoCalib : bool, optional 

285 Apply external photoCalib to calibrate fluxes. 

286 externalPhotoCalibName : str, optional 

287 Type of external `PhotoCalib` to apply. Currently supported are jointcal, 

288 fgcm, and fgcm_tract. Must be set if doApplyExternalPhotoCalib is True. 

289 doApplyExternalSkyWcs : bool, optional 

290 Apply external wcs to calibrate positions. 

291 externalSkyWcsName : str, optional 

292 Type of external `wcs` to apply. Currently supported is jointcal. 

293 Must be set if "doApplyExternalSkyWcs" is True. 

294 skipTEx : bool, optional 

295 Skip TEx calculations (useful for older catalogs that don't have 

296 PsfShape measurements). 

297 verbose : bool, optional 

298 Output additional information on the analysis steps. 

299 skipNonSrd : bool, optional 

300 Skip any metrics not defined in the LSST SRD. 

301 

302 Raises 

303 ------ 

304 RuntimeError: 

305 Raised if "doApplyExternalPhotoCalib" is True and "externalPhotoCalibName" 

306 is None, or if "doApplyExternalSkyWcs" is True and "externalSkyWcsName" is 

307 None. 

308 """ 

309 

310 if kwargs: 

311 log.warn(f"Extra kwargs - {kwargs}, will be ignored. Did you add extra things to your config file?") 

312 

313 if doApplyExternalPhotoCalib and externalPhotoCalibName is None: 

314 raise RuntimeError("Must set externalPhotoCalibName if doApplyExternalPhotoCalib is True.") 

315 if doApplyExternalSkyWcs and externalSkyWcsName is None: 

316 raise RuntimeError("Must set externalSkyWcsName if doApplyExternalSkyWcs is True.") 

317 

318 # collect just the common key, value pairs to omit the keys that are aggregated over 

319 job_metadata = dict(set.intersection(*[set(vid.items()) for vid in visitDataIds])) 

320 

321 # update with metadata passed into the method 

322 job_metadata.update({'instrument': instrument, 

323 'filter_name': filterName, 

324 'dataset_repo_url': dataset_repo_url}) 

325 

326 job = Job.load_metrics_package(meta=job_metadata, 

327 subset='validate_drp', 

328 package_name_or_path=metrics_package) 

329 

330 matchedDataset = build_matched_dataset(repo, visitDataIds, 

331 doApplyExternalPhotoCalib=doApplyExternalPhotoCalib, 

332 externalPhotoCalibName=externalPhotoCalibName, 

333 doApplyExternalSkyWcs=doApplyExternalSkyWcs, 

334 externalSkyWcsName=externalSkyWcsName, 

335 skipTEx=skipTEx, skipNonSrd=skipNonSrd, 

336 brightSnrMin=brightSnrMin, brightSnrMax=brightSnrMax) 

337 

338 snr = matchedDataset['snr'].quantity 

339 bright = (matchedDataset['brightSnrMin'].quantity < snr) & ( 

340 snr < matchedDataset['brightSnrMax'].quantity) 

341 photomModel = build_photometric_error_model(matchedDataset, bright) 

342 astromModel = build_astrometric_error_model(matchedDataset, bright) 

343 

344 linkedBlobs = [matchedDataset, photomModel, astromModel] 

345 

346 metrics = job.metrics 

347 specs = job.specs 

348 

349 def add_measurement(measurement): 

350 for blob in linkedBlobs: 

351 measurement.link_blob(blob) 

352 job.measurements.insert(measurement) 

353 

354 for x, D in zip((1, 2, 3), (5., 20., 200.)): 

355 amxName = 'AM{0:d}'.format(x) 

356 afxName = 'AF{0:d}'.format(x) 

357 adxName = 'AD{0:d}'.format(x) 

358 

359 amx = measureAMx(metrics['validate_drp.'+amxName], matchedDataset, D*u.arcmin, verbose=verbose) 

360 add_measurement(amx) 

361 

362 afx_spec_set = specs.subset(required_meta={'instrument': 'HSC'}, spec_tags=[afxName, ]) 

363 adx_spec_set = specs.subset(required_meta={'instrument': 'HSC'}, spec_tags=[adxName, ]) 

364 for afx_spec_key, adx_spec_key in zip(afx_spec_set, adx_spec_set): 

365 afx_spec = afx_spec_set[afx_spec_key] 

366 adx_spec = adx_spec_set[adx_spec_key] 

367 adx = measureADx(metrics[adx_spec.metric_name], amx, afx_spec) 

368 add_measurement(adx) 

369 afx = measureAFx(metrics[afx_spec.metric_name], amx, adx, adx_spec) 

370 add_measurement(afx) 

371 

372 pa1 = measurePA1( 

373 metrics['validate_drp.PA1'], filterName, matchedDataset.matchesBright, matchedDataset.magKey) 

374 add_measurement(pa1) 

375 

376 pf1_spec_set = specs.subset(required_meta={'instrument': instrument, 'filter_name': filterName}, 

377 spec_tags=['PF1', ]) 

378 pa2_spec_set = specs.subset(required_meta={'instrument': instrument, 'filter_name': filterName}, 

379 spec_tags=['PA2', ]) 

380 # I worry these might not always be in the right order. Sorting... 

381 pf1_spec_keys = list(pf1_spec_set.keys()) 

382 pa2_spec_keys = list(pa2_spec_set.keys()) 

383 pf1_spec_keys.sort() 

384 pa2_spec_keys.sort() 

385 for pf1_spec_key, pa2_spec_key in zip(pf1_spec_keys, pa2_spec_keys): 

386 pf1_spec = pf1_spec_set[pf1_spec_key] 

387 pa2_spec = pa2_spec_set[pa2_spec_key] 

388 

389 pa2 = measurePA2(metrics[pa2_spec.metric_name], pa1, pf1_spec.threshold) 

390 add_measurement(pa2) 

391 

392 pf1 = measurePF1(metrics[pf1_spec.metric_name], pa1, pa2_spec) 

393 add_measurement(pf1) 

394 

395 if not skipTEx: 

396 for x, D, bin_range_operator in zip((1, 2), (1.0, 5.0), ("<=", ">=")): 

397 texName = 'TE{0:d}'.format(x) 

398 tex = measureTEx(metrics['validate_drp.'+texName], matchedDataset, D*u.arcmin, 

399 bin_range_operator, verbose=verbose) 

400 add_measurement(tex) 

401 

402 if not skipNonSrd: 

403 model_phot_reps = measure_model_phot_rep(metrics, filterName, matchedDataset) 

404 for measurement in model_phot_reps: 

405 add_measurement(measurement) 

406 

407 if makeJson: 

408 job.write(outputPrefix+'.json') 

409 

410 return job
